Job Description
Web-Based Graphical Interface Engineer at The PAC Group designing interfaces for energy management systems. Engaging with teams for seamless platform integration and user experience.
Responsibilities:
- Design, develop, and maintain web-based graphical user interfaces within the DGLUX / ENVYSION (Distech Controls) environment.
- Build intuitive and responsive UI components for HVAC, lighting, energy systems, and IoT platforms.
- Develop and integrate automation strategies using industry-standard open protocols, including BACnet, Modbus, MQTT, and RESTful APIs.
- Translate engineering designs and functional requirements into accurate, real-time graphical dashboards and control pages.
- Work closely with project engineers, BMS programmers, and data analysts to ensure seamless platform integration and user experience.
- Optimise system performance by troubleshooting communication issues and validating data flow across protocols.
- Ensure graphical standards, templates, and workflows are documented and scalable across multiple projects.
- Support commissioning teams during testing, validation, and final delivery.
- (Desirable) Integrate dashboards and data flows with energy analytics platforms such as SkySpark.
Requirements:
- Proven experience with Niagara/N4.
- Proven experience creating GUIs within the DGLUX or ENVYSION platform (Distech Controls).
- Strong understanding of building automation, IoT, or energy management systems.
- Strong understanding of building automation protocols (BACnet/IP, Modbus TCP/RTU, MQTT).
- Ability to interpret BMS schematics, control strategies, and point lists.
- Proficiency in HTML5, CSS, JavaScript, and responsive interface principles.
- Experience integrating real-time data systems into web-based interfaces.
- Excellent problem-solving skills with the ability to diagnose system communication or data issues.
- Solid understanding of IP networking, VLANs, addressing schemas, firewalls, and secure system architecture
- Experience with databases, JSON structures, or cloud-based integration workflows
